<p>One of the largest music retailers in the United States, the client was seeking a method for saving time and money on IT projects. The client had been using a waterfall style development for all IT projects, resulting in projects that were over-budget and unable to deliver the business value determined during the initial design phase.</p>
<h2>Solution:</h2>
<p>Agile trainers conducted a multi-day training clinic on Agile method adoption for all client stakeholders.<br />
The sessions were customized to the client’s environment, focusing on the specific software and platforms used during project development. To ensure the training was relevant and effective, business issues that pertained to the client were addressed during the training session.</p>
<h2>Result:</h2>
<p>The client mastered the Agile delivery model within six months, creating a faster, more efficient, and adaptive IT department. The client saw significant improvement in project delivery timelines and consistent delivery framework across all projects</p>
